Default TRS Bellhousing studs

Anyone know the correct diameter/thread pitch for the studs the mount the drive to the bellhousing? My steering plates mount over these, so I need longer ones than stock. About 1/2 inch longer. Tried latham, no luck.

The threads that screw into the bell housing are 1/2"-13 NC and the threads which are used for the nuts that hold the drive on are 1/2"-20 NF.Total length of the stud is 3 1/2" with 1 3/8" of unthreaded area in the center.

I got mine even for the #4 at ARP ,,,for a fraction of the merc price. I paid like 6 bucks each and mercc whanted 76 bucks each.

Just call and tell them length diameter and thread sizes.
Also how much non threadet erea in the center and they match it up ,,,plus there studs are even stronger .
